Windows 10でインストールしたプログラムを別のドライブに効率的に転送する方法

Windows 10 でインストールしたプログラムを別のドライブに移動するのは必ずしも簡単ではありませんが、特にプログラムやゲームのコレクションが大量にある場合は、メインの SSD または C: ドライブのスペースを大幅に解放できます。問題は、すべてのアプリが別の場所にドラッグアンドドロップするように設計されているわけではないことです。一部はレジストリエントリまたはシステムパスに関連付けられているため、少し工夫が必要です。このガイドでは、組み込みの Windows オプション (一部のアプリ用) と、プロセスを自動化または簡素化するサードパーティ製ツールの両方について説明します。最終目標は、何も壊すことなくスペースを解放することですが、これは Windows が必要以上に困難にすることを好むため、難しい場合があります。うまくいけば、これで頭痛の種が減り、ソフトウェアがスムーズに再配置され、PC が少しクリーンで高速に動作するようになります。

Windows 10でインストールしたプログラムを別のドライブに移動する方法

ターゲットドライブの空き容量を確認する

まず、データを移動先のドライブに十分な空き容量があることを確認してください。新しいドライブがいっぱい、あるいはほぼいっぱいになっている場合は、移動を開始しても意味がありません。ファイルエクスプローラー(タスクバーのフォルダーアイコン)を開き、左ペインの「PC」をクリックします。移動先ドライブ(たとえばD:またはE:)の空き容量を確認しましょう。移動予定の容量よりも多くの空き容量(GB)を確保しておくと、データが途切れたり、おかしな動きをしたりすることがなくなります。データを移動したのに空き容量が全くないなんて、本当にイライラしますよね。

セットアップによっては、ドライブが適切にフォーマットされているかどうか、または奇妙な権限を持つ外付けドライブであるかどうかを確認する必要がある場合があります。これは、後で問題を引き起こす可能性があります。

特定のアプリを移動するためにWindows設定を使用する

Windowsストアアプリや一部のユニバーサルWindowsプラットフォーム(UWP)アプリの場合は、これが最も簡単な方法です。「設定」 > 「アプリ」 > 「アプリと機能」に進みます。リストをスクロールして、移動をサポートしているアプリを探します。アプリをタップすると、オプションが表示されている場合は「移動」ボタンが表示されます。移動先のドライブを選択して「OK」をクリックします。この方法はMicrosoftストアからインストールしたアプリでは問題なく機能しますが、すべてのデスクトッププログラムがサポートしているわけではありません。ボタンがあるはずなのに、表示されない場合もあります。

注意: Windows 10 の一部のバージョンまたは特定のアプリでは、この機能が制限されていたり不安定だったりする場合があります。そのため、特定のプログラムで機能しない場合でも、心配する必要はありません。

ストア外アプリにはサードパーティ製ツールを使用する

ここから少し複雑になります。Winhance、Steam Mover、FreeMoveなどのツールが必要になるでしょうこれらユーティリティはシンボリックリンクを作成することで動作します。つまり、Windowsはアプリが以前と同じ場所にあると認識しますが、実際には新しいドライブ上に存在します。このプロセスでは通常、アプリケーションフォルダ( などC:\Program Files)を選択し、新しい場所を選択します。その後、アプリが自動的にリンクを作成します。

注意:一部のプログラムは、特にWindowsと深く統合されていたり、複雑な依存関係があったりする場合は、移行が面倒になることがあります。しかし、全体としては、この方法の方が再インストールや再設定の手間を省くことができます。

重要なデータをまずバックアップする

言うまでもないかもしれませんが、作業を始める前に重要なファイルをバックアップしておくことをお勧めします。いつ何が起こるか分かりません。特に、プログラムを移動した後に起動しなくなった場合はなおさらです。Windowsに標準装備されているバックアップと復元「設定」>「更新とセキュリティ」>「バックアップ」)を使用するか、念のため重要なファイルを外付けドライブにコピーしておきましょう。安全第一、ですよね?

念のため、この方法を試す前にOSドライブのクローンを作成する人もいます。Windowsでは、この手順を本来よりも少し複雑にする必要があるためです。

移動を実行して検証する

ツールの準備とバックアップが完了したら、各ツールの指示に従ってアプリを移行します。移行するアプリと移行先を選択します。移行後、プログラムが正しく起動するかどうかを確認してください。移行によって依存関係が壊れる場合は、アプリを管理者として実行したり、設定を再設定したりする必要があるかもしれません。

一部のマシンでは、最初は少し動作が不安定になる場合があります。アプリケーションがエラーを出力したり、起動しなくなったりするなどです。慌てる必要はありません。通常は再起動または再起動すれば直ります。また、一部のプログラムが全く動かなくなる場合もありますが、これは正常な動作です。すべてがスムーズに動作するとは限りません。

Windows 10でインストールしたプログラムを別のドライブに移動するためのヒント

  • アプリが移動をサポートしていることを確認してください。まずベンダーのドキュメントまたはフォーラムを確認してください。
  • ゲームや大きなソフトウェア スイートなどの大きなアプリを最初に移動すると、大量のスペースがすぐに解放されます。
  • サードパーティのツールを最新の状態に保ってください。バグは発生しますが、アップデートで修正されます。
  • パフォーマンスの低下やエラーを防ぐために、ドライブを定期的に監視してください。
  • 特定のプログラムについてのヒントについては、フォーラムや Reddit を参照してください。巧妙なトリックを持っている人がいることもあります。

よくある質問

すべてのプログラムを別のドライブに移動できますか?

いいえ、そうではありません。ストアアプリや一部のポータブルアプリは通常は問題ありませんが、従来のデスクトップソフトウェアはWindowsと密接に連携していることが多いため、特別なツールや再インストールが必要になる場合もあります。

プログラムを移動するのは安全ですか?

バックアップ、互換性のあるアプリ、慎重な移行といった手順を踏めば、概ね安全です。それでも、特に複雑なソフトウェアの場合は、何かが壊れるリスクが常に存在します。

管理者権限は必要ですか?

はい、その通りです。インストールされたプログラムを移動するには、システムファイルとレジストリエントリが関係するため、通常は管理者権限が必要です。

移動後にプログラムが動作しなくなったらどうなりますか?

元の場所に戻すか、新しいドライブに再インストールしてみてください。アプリを移動すると、レジストリパスや依存関係が乱れ、エラーが発生する場合があります。

プログラムを移動すると PC の速度は上がりますか?

まあ、そうですね。主に空き容量を増やすのに役立ち、メインドライブがほぼいっぱいになった場合に全体的な速度を向上させることができます。ただし、パフォーマンスの問題を魔法のように解決するわけではなく、単にスペースを節約するだけです。

まとめ

  • ターゲットドライブに十分な空き容量があるかどうかを確認します。
  • 可能な場合は、Windows 設定を使用してストアにインストールされたアプリを移動します。
  • より複雑なデスクトップ アプリについては、サードパーティ ツールをお試しください。
  • 始める前にすべてをバックアップしてください。
  • 指示に注意深く従い、その後プログラムをテストしてください。

まとめ

このプロセスは完璧ではありませんし、すべてのプログラムがスムーズに移行できるわけではありません。それでも、少しの忍耐とツールがあれば、間違いなく実行可能です。特にメインドライブの容量が不足している場合は、空き容量を増やし、システムの動作を少し速くするのに非常に役立ちます。ただし、扱いにくいアプリの場合は試行錯誤が必要になることを覚悟し、必ず事前にバックアップを取ってください。うまくいくことを祈ります。これでクリーンアップ時間が数時間短縮されるといいですね!